### Capacity Note: Health Checks on the Larkspur Tier

The Larkspur load balancer probes each backend on a fixed interval; aggressive settings caused a cascading drain incident last spring, so these values are deliberately conservative. If you add backends, recheck that aggregate probe traffic stays under 1% of capacity. Future maintainers should treat the constants below as a tested baseline, not a ceiling.

tuning table, fahof-kageg:
QUOTAS = {
    "holius": 478,
    "ralius": 171,
    "holael": 86,
    "kelath": 373,
    "zorox": 963,
    "ulaox": 75,
    "olieth": 199,
}

**Alert: tailfox CLI — tail session failures**

The tailfox CLI is failing to open tail sessions against the Greymarsh log brokers. Error rate above 30% for 15 minutes. Release impact: deploy verification relies on live tails, so holds may be needed. Workaround: use the batch-pull mode until sessions recover. Triage steps and current broker status are tracked on the page below.

dashboard of bajef-bageg = https://confluence.lumiclabs.internal/browse/browse/pages/display/93ae

Release checklist — FoldFast locker access flow. Before sign-off, verify that the locker-open sequence in the TumbleHub app completes end to end: request a locker, confirm the door actuates within the two-second window, and check that the reservation releases cleanly on cancel. New team members: walk the flow on both staging kiosks in the Brampton Yard test lab, not just the simulator. Record any retry prompts you see. Once verified, attach the build token that corresponds to your test run.

build token for yajof-bajof: htk31_506ff1188f74596b5bb2eec94edc43c

## Deploying the Gatewick Proctor Queue

Deploys are pretty painless: push to main, wait for the pipeline, then watch the queue drain dashboard for five minutes. If candidates pile up mid-exam, roll back first and ask questions later — the queue replays safely. Everything the workers care about lives in one config block, shown here for reference.

settings of bafof-yagef:
JOROX_PIN=8740
JOROX_TENANT=pelox
JOROX_METRICS_HOST=metrics.jorox.qorvelworks.internal
JOROX_SEAL=seal_c78f63c1
JOROX_STANDBY_TEAM=norax